Typically, packages with this pattern of @@ -900,16 +566,14 @@ containing both a library and a binary crate will have just enough code in the binary crate to start an executable that calls code with the library crate. This lets other projects benefit from the most functionality that the package provides because the library crate’s code can be shared. - - +> > The module tree should be defined in *src/lib.rs*. Then, any public items can be used in the binary crate by starting paths with the name of the package. The binary crate becomes a user of the library crate just like a completely external crate would use the library crate: it can only use the public API. This helps you design a good API; not only are you the author, you’re also a client! - - +> > In Chapter 12, we’ll demonstrate this organizational practice with a command line program that will contain both a binary crate and a library crate. @@ -933,41 +597,14 @@ Filename: src/lib.rs ``` fn deliver_order() {} -``` -``` - -``` - -``` mod back_of_house { -``` - -``` fn fix_incorrect_order() { -``` - -``` cook_order(); For a module named `front_of_house` declared in the crate root, the compiler will look for the module’s code in: - - -Unmatched: BoxListBullet - -Unmatched: BoxListBullet - +> +> * *src/front_of_house.rs* (what we covered) +> * *src/front_of_house/mod.rs* (older style, still supported path) +> > For a module named `hosting` that is a submodule of `front_of_house`, the compiler will look for the module’s code in: - - -Unmatched: BoxListBullet - -Unmatched: BoxListBullet - +> +> * *src/front_of_house/hosting.rs* (what we covered) +> * *src/front_of_house/hosting/mod.rs* (older style, still supported path) +> > If you use both styles for the same module, you’ll get a compiler error. Using a mix of both styles for different modules in the same project is allowed, but might be confusing for people navigating your project. - - +> > The main downside to the style that uses files named *mod.rs* is that your project can end up with many files named *mod.rs*, which can get confusing when you have them open in your editor at the same time.
